By walking through Matthew 2 and the familiar story of the wise men, Jay highlights a surprising and often overlooked truth: the religious leaders of Jesus’ time knew exactly where the Messiah would be born, yet they didn’t travel even six miles to go see Him. With powerful insight, Jay urges us not to fall into the same pattern—knowing all the right verses and attending all the right events while missing the presence of God Himself.
